10 Australia’s Richest Women Of 2023
As of today, Gina Rinehart is known to be the richest woman in Australia. She is a mining magnet with an estimated net worth of around $26.5 Billion.
Here is the list of the top 10 richest women in Australia in 2023.
Gina Rinehart
Gina Rinehart has been a poster girl for the richest woman with a net worth of $28.1 billion in Australia for several years. She is known to be the biggest and most powerful person in the mining industry.
Gina Rinehart took over the control of the company Hancock Prospecting, which her father established.
Fiona Geminder
Fiona is known to be a billionaire heiress and daughter of Late Richard Pratt. Fiona Geminder has a net worth of $3.3 billion.
Aside from her inherited stakes at Visy, she also owned and established her company, PACT Group, with her husband.
Melanie Perkins
Melanie is a self-made billionaire with a net worth of $6.5 billion. She is a co-founder of Canva, a technology startup, and CEO of Canva, which is a graphic design platform.
Bianca Rinehart
Bianca and her siblings are awarded legally when they win a suit against Gina Rinehart ( their mother). She was given the shares of the family trust, making her a billionaire heiress. Bianca has a net worth of $2.1 billion.
Naomi Milgrom
She is a heiress, but Naomi chartered her own way to become one of the richest women in the fashion industry. She has a net worth of $765 million.
Naomi is the founder of the Sportsgirl company, which makes women’s sportswear. She also has control over the brand Susan that her father co-founded with John Gandel.
Heloise Pratt
Heloise has $3.1 billion; she is a businesswoman, daughter of Richart Pratt, and sister of Anthony and Fiona. Like her siblings, she also owns Visy Industries, which is one of the biggest packaging companies worldwide.
Heloise also owns a football club, investments in real estate, and owner of a wealth management company.
Gretel Lees Packer
Gretel is Kerry Packer’s daughter, a famous name in hotels and casinos. After his death, she inherited his interest in the business Crown Resorts.
Apart from this, she is also an investor. Gretel has a net worth of $1.6 billion, making her a billionaire heiress.
Judith Neilson
Judith has a net worth of 1.5 billion dollars. She is a member of the Order of Australia. She was listed as a Billionaire after she divorced Kerr Neilson, her husband. She is also a part owner of a company co-founded by her ex-husband.
Angela Bennett
Angela has $1.2 billion, which makes her a billionaire mining heiress in Australia. She inherited the company Wright Prospecting, which her father, Peter Wright co-founded.
Angela also worked with Fina Rinehart, but due to lawsuits between them, their working relationship was not good.
Robyn Denholm
Robin is the chairwoman of Tesla and succeeded Elon Musk in 2018. She has a net worth of $688 million. She previously worked for Sun Microsystem, Juniper Networks, and Toyota Australia.
